We are seeking a full-time Clinical Psychologist (fully licensed or Provisional Psychologists welcome) to join our team at Reception and Medical Center located in Lake Butler, Florida, just 25 miles north of Gainesville.   This is a large male correctional hospital providing reception services, as well as,  inpatient and outpatient psychological services.  

This site qualifies NHSC Loan Repayment and has a qualifying score of 6!  

The Psychologist provides psychological leadership, consultation and direct services for patients in an assigned facility. The Psychologist will collaborate with a multidisciplinary team in providing assessment and treatment of mental and emotional disorders of patients.

Advantages of Working in Correctional Healthcare

  • Ability to spend time with your patients. No more cancellations or “no shows”
  • Salary is consistent and is not based on patient volume
  • Freedom from complex, restrictive managed care policies and reimbursement hassles
  • Time to initiate change, track progress and conduct better follow-up
  • Ability to work with a clinically rich and diverse patient population
  • Not required to sign employment contracts or non-compete agreements
